Baked Lobster Tails with Garlic Butter

Here’s a simple and delicious recipe for Baked Lobster Tails with Garlic Butter — perfect for a special dinner or holiday meal.


🦞 Baked Lobster Tails with Garlic Butter

⭐ Ingredients:

  • 4 lobster tails (5–6 oz each)

  • 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ted

  • 4 garlic cloves, minced

  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ice (freshly squeezed)

  • 1 teaspoon paprika

  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per

  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ped (optional)

  • Lemon wedges, for serving


🔪 Instructions:

  1. Preheat Oven:
    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with foil.

  2. Prepare Lobster Tails:

    • Use kitchen scissors to cut down the top of each lobster shell, from the wide end to the tail, without cutting the tail fin.

    • Gently lift the lobster meat out of the shell and rest it on top (leave it attached at the base).

    • Place prepared tails on the baking sheet.

  3. Make Garlic Butter:

    • In a small bowl, combine melted butter, minced garlic, lemon juice, paprika, salt, and pepper.

  4. Brush and Bake:

    • Brush the garlic butter mixture generously over the lobster meat.

    • Bake in the preheated oven for 10–12 minutes, or until the meat is opaque and slightly browned.

  5. Broil for Finish (Optional):

    • For a golden top, broil the tails on high for an additional 1–2 minutes, watching carefully.

  6. Serve:

    • Sprinkle with fresh parsley and serve immediately with lemon wedges and extra garlic butter on the side.
